Vincent Thomas Courtney was born on September 17, 1933, the son of Harry and Stella (Carolan) Courtney, at their home near Bluffton, IA. At the age of 65 it was discovered the date of his birth was mis-recorded so his birthday legally became September 18, when he was 65 years old. Vince attended Cresco High School in Cresco, Iowa. He was united in marriage with Dolores (Peter) Courtney on November 28, 1953, in Cresco, Iowa, and to this union six children were born: Debra, Diane, Darla, Donna, Craig and Christopher. Vince held a variety of jobs in his early adult years and then started working at the Cresco Cleaners in the 1950’s. This began his life-long career in the dry cleaning industry, which took the family from Cresco, to Rochester, MN, and then to Omaha, NE. Vince successfully managed the large operation for many years. Then in 1984 at the age of 50 he opened his own dry cleaning business. He proved his proficiency for business once again with Camelot Cleaners. Dolores and much of the family worked at the cleaners over the years. It is now owned and operated by his sons, Craig and Chris. Vince was hard driven and worked long hours to build his business and he was extremely proud of it. Besides work, he enjoyed boating on the river. He and Dolores bought a house on Lake of the Ozarks and he loved spending time there with friends and family. He also enjoyed pheasant hunting and went on several Canadian fishing trips with his sons and good friends. Later he enjoyed trips to Scottsdale to play golf.
